释义 | disturbUK:*/dɪˈstɜːrb/US:/dɪˈstɝb/ ,(di stûrb′)UK-RP:UK-Yorkshire:Irish:Scottish:US Southern:Jamaican: 主要翻译 disturb [sb] vtr (interrupt: [sb] busy) (人)打扰,打搅,干扰The professor went home to work, as her students kept disturbing her in her office.因为不堪受学生来办公室打扰,教授就回家工作去了。usage: ‘disturb’If you disturb someone, you interrupt what they are doing and cause them inconvenience.If she's asleep, don't disturb her.Sorry to disturb you, but can I use your telephone? disturb [sth] vtr (activity: interrupt)打扰;干扰;妨碍The noise outside disturbed Robert's work.外面的噪音干扰了罗伯特的工作。 disturb [sth] vtr (interrupt: sleep) (睡眠)打扰;干扰;妨碍Worry about the forthcoming exam disturbed Linda's sleep.对即将到来的考试的忧虑妨碍了琳达的睡眠。 disturb [sb] vtr (upset, trouble) (人)使...心神不安;使...烦恼;使...心烦意乱The boss's strange behaviour was starting to disturb George.老板奇怪的举止开始使乔治心神不安。 disturb [sth] vtr (move, mess up)弄乱;乱动Please don't disturb the papers on my desk; I know they look untidy, but I know where everything is.请不要弄乱我桌子上的纸;我知道看起来不太整洁,但什么东西在哪里我都清楚。 复合形式: do not disturb v expr written (do not interrupt) (书面语)请勿打扰 do-not-disturb adj (sign, notice: not to enter room) (酒店吊牌)勿扰的;请勿打扰的James put a do-not-disturb sign on his hotel door so that he could take a nap. |
